Protecting Your Home: Where Your Family Gathers
Your home is the hub of all the back-to-school chaos—and the sanctuary you come back to at the end of the day. As you get your house ready for the school year, consider your homeowners or renters insurance.
- Is my home insurance ready for the school year? 🏡
- Are your children’s new laptops, tablets, and expensive sports equipment covered in case of theft or damage?
- If your high schooler or college student is moving into a dorm, are their belongings still covered under your existing policy? (Did you know that many policies offer limited coverage for students’ property away from home?)
- What about liability?
- If a friend or carpool child gets injured on your property, are you protected from liability?

Protecting Your Vehicle: The School-Year Shuttle
The back-to-school rush often means more time on the road for drop-offs, pickups, and after-school activities. If you have a new teen driver in the house, these questions become even more critical.
- Is my auto insurance ready for more time on the road? 🚗
- Are all the drivers in your household listed on your policy?
- If you have a young driver, are you taking advantage of available discounts, such as a “Good Student Discount” for their grades or a “Driver’s Education Discount” for a course they’ve completed?
- Does your coverage offer roadside assistance for those unexpected flat tires or breakdowns?
